LottoGo called me a "true problem gambler" and threatened to report me to the police


Recommended Posts

Posted

Hi everyone,

I’m genuinely shocked and not sure what to do next, so I’m hoping someone here can help or advise me.

I recently contacted LottoGo to raise a serious issue around responsible gaming. I've had an account with them that's fully verified but I've been with gamstop for 4+ years. I told them and gave them by gamstop reg document and they began this argument over mis-matched data (it all matched with gamstop except my phone and email)

After reviewing my account, they’ve now refunded the deposits I made using my business debit card (around £680). that I had to make them aware of in the first place, but the email they sent was unbelievable. They said the refund was a “gesture of goodwill” because I’m “a true problem gambler,” accused me of providing misleading information when it's literally identical, and even said that my actions “might be determined as fraud by misrepresentation,” warning they might report me to the police.

They still refuse to refund the rest of my deposits (£320 made with my personal debit card), even though all my details (surname, DOB, and full address) match my GAMSTOP record exactly.

This whole situation has really shocked me. I used my correct personal details, verified my account with my passport and bank statement, and yet they’re acting like I tried to deceive them, while they’re the ones who seem to have failed to do any kind of checks?!

Has anyone experienced anything similar with LottoGo??

Can they really threaten police action when I’ve done nothing wrong?

Any advice or next steps would be massively appreciated.
